The Wicklow Heather Restaurant, offers a blend of traditional Irish and continental cuisine. Choose from our A La Carte Lunch and Dinner menus as well as a varied selection of daily specials. All dishes are freshly prepared using locally sourced organic produce where possible. The Wicklow Heather signature dishes include Panko Coated Fish Cake from fresh and smoked seafood, served with citrus aioli, Roast Rump of Wicklow Lamb on creamy garlic gratin potato, parsnip puree and balsamic roasted shallots or perhaps our Crunchy Chicken Parmesan served on spring onion champ mash, Clonakilty black pudding, smoked Gubbeen belly bacon stuffing with creamy wild mushroom sauce . Wicklow heifer beef sourced from the Locally village Reared Aughrim are fully traceable from farm to fork. Indulge yourself with one of our mouth-watering homemade desserts, maybe Salted caramel chocolate Fondant Toasted walnut crumb and vanilla ice-cream .

GRANO combines fresh natural ingredients, farmed using organic and biodynamic techniques, to create a contemporary cuisine that respects the roots and traditions of Italian cooking.By sourcing our ingredients from small Italian food and wine producers, it is our mission to contribute to the preservation of local food cultures and the revival of ancient cultivation techniques.

FIRE is located in the heart of Dublin city centre on the popular Dawson St. Offering an unforgettable dining experience in Dublin's most historical dining room along with exclusive private dining options. Soaring 19th-century ceilings, stained glass windows and bronze sculptures are just a few elements of this magnificent dining space.FIRE also offers 'outdoor dining' on our incredible fully enclosed, weatherproof and heated terrace overlooking the beautiful Lord Mayor’s Garden.We pride ourselves on creating menus around locally sourced Irish produce. Firmly committed to supporting sustainable local produce we serve the finest selection of meats and produce that Ireland has to offer. Our concept is very simple, take Ireland's finest raw ingredients and use original recipes to create exceptional dishes.
